Lead Ingots – Product Overview

HUTKA SA manufactures high-density Lead Ingots engineered for diverse industrial applications. As a cost-effective and efficient metallic form, our ingots are well-suited for general use in casting, refining, and chemical processing.

Standard ingot dimensions: approximately 2–3 cm × 3–8 cm × 6–12 cm. Custom sizes and specifications are available based on project requirements.

Our lead is refined using advanced processes such as crystallization, solid-state purification, and sublimation—ensuring superior purity and structural consistency. These materials are ideal for both commercial production and specialized R&D applications.

Lead Ingot Properties (Theoretical)

Molecular Weight207.2
AppearanceBluish white
Melting Point327.502 °C
Boiling Point1740 °C
Density11.35 g/cm3
Solubility in H2ON/A
Electrical Resistivity20.648 microhm-cm @ 20 °C
Electronegativity1.8 Paulings
Heat of Fusion1.224 Cal/gm mole
Heat of Vaporization42.4 K-Cal/gm atom at 1740 °C
Poisson’s Ratio0.44
Specific Heat0.038 Cal/g/oK @ 25 °C
Tensile StrengthN/A
Thermal Conductivity0.353 W/cm/K @ 298.2 K
Thermal Expansion(25 °C) 28.9 µm·m-1·K-1
Vickers HardnessN/A
Young’s Modulus16 GPa
